Reduced-intensity conditioning transplantation in myeloid malignancies [PDF]
The development of non-myeloablative and reduced-intensity conditioning regimens has enabled older or medically infirm patients with myeloid malignancies to be treated with allogeneic hematopoietic cell transplantation (HCT).
